I get why men and women may well need to pool their dollars to buy stuff. But why is a completely new, copyright-dependent governance structure necessary for that? Couldn’t They only use a standard crowdfunding site? They could. And, in some instances, a DAO could possibly be better off using a platform like Kickstarter, mainly because employing copyright to boost big amounts of funds can result in users having to pay exorbitant transaction fees. When ConstitutionDAO elevated $47 million, for example, its consumers paid out roughly $1.2 million in service fees on the Ethereum network. Ouch. Are there almost every other downsides to DAOs? Some DAOs have discovered that decentralized, blockchain-based governance is messier than it looks. The first-ever DAO, which was only known as the DAO, elevated in excess of $one hundred fifty million to make a style of crowdfunded expenditure organization, then went up in flames amid a host of legal, governance and stability difficulties. related problems have plagued other DAOs due to the fact then. DAOs may additionally run into authorized problems if regulators determine which the tokens they situation are securities, As a result demanding them to go through the exact same registration approach as a business advertising stocks or bonds. In 2017, the Securities and Trade Fee found that DAO Tokens, the indigenous token in the DAO, were in fact securities, and should have been issue to securities law. The the latest DAO boom has also raised eyebrows among the regulators and law enforcement organizations, that are worried that some DAOs could simply just be fronts for fraud. “in some instances, copyright investors and regulators say, the ventures sum to Ponzi strategies meant to do minimal more than bolster the value with the electronic tokens they provide,” my colleagues Eric Lipton and Ephrat Livni wrote in a the latest piece on some of the issues struggling with DAOs.
